Concrete foundation sealing services involve the application of protective coatings or sealants to the surface of a building’s foundation. This process helps create a barrier that prevents moisture, water infiltration, and other environmental elements from penetrating the concrete. Proper sealing can enhance the durability of the foundation, reduce the risk of cracks caused by moisture expansion and contraction, and extend the lifespan of the structure. Professionals typically assess the condition of the existing foundation, clean the surface thoroughly, and then apply a suitable sealant designed to withstand local weather conditions and soil characteristics.
Sealing services address common problems associated with unprotected foundations, such as water leaks, dampness, and the formation of mold or mildew. Water intrusion can lead to structural damage over time, including cracking, shifting, or settling of the foundation. Additionally, moisture infiltration can cause interior issues like basement flooding or increased humidity levels. By sealing the foundation, property owners can mitigate these issues, helping to preserve the integrity of the building and maintain a healthier indoor environment.

Cost Range for Basic Sealing - The typical cost for sealing a standard concrete foundation is between $500 and $1,500. This includes surface preparation and application of sealant or waterproofing coatings by local service providers.
Factors Influencing Price - Larger or more complex foundations may cost between $1,500 and $3,000. Additional work such as crack repairs or moisture mitigation can increase the overall expense.
Material and Method Variations - The choice of sealing materials, such as epoxy or elastomeric coatings, affects costs, which generally range from $4 to $10 per square foot. Different application techniques may also influence the total price.
Regional Cost Differences - Costs for foundation sealing services in Newark, IL, and nearby areas typically fall within these ranges, but prices can vary based on local contractor rates and accessibility of the foundation.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
